H A Dcpu_helpers.S71f7a363fe9d5aa6466ffd4b663cf52d9033deaa Mon Aug 18 14:38:30 UTC 2025 Boyan Karatotev <boyan.karatotev@arm.com> fix(aarch32): make get_cpu_ops_ptr() PCS compliant

The get_cpu_ops_ptr() function gets called from C (mainly in errata
reporting) but it is not PCS compliant - it clobbers r4 and r5. This
doesn't usually cause any problems, but if the stars align it blows up.

Convert the heart of the function to a non-PCS compliant macro that can
be invoked in the early entrypoint code and change the get_cpu_ops_ptr()
to a PCS compliant wrapper for calling into C. Additionally, the
resultant inlining in the entrypoint will lead to a tiny performance
bump due to the one fewer jump to an uncached memory location.
